SOLVED (for me at least)

After soooo many hours of searching relief finally arrived.

I am running Win 7 64 bit HP SP1.

I "MOVED" the "hidden" folder C:\recovery to a flash drive and rebooted. Everything worked after that. The Recovery folder was recreated. I can only assume the original was somehow corrupted.
